I have a A31p (2653-RQG) where the battery is not charged any more. Does somebody know how I could fix that problem?

History:

One day I noticed that the battery is not charged and the laptop doesn't get power from the power supply. The cable between power outlet and power supply was apparently broken and I replaced it. Then the laptop worked with the power supply again. However, it doesn't charge the battery since then. It runs from power supply and it runs from a charged battery.

I'd guess that the faulty AC adapter cord blew a fuse on the system board that is associated with the battery charging circuitry, or some other component in the charging circuitry went south..
